    Actually they are excellent boats, great holeshot and handle like a sports car. They are a wet ride if you are not drivnig them agreesively in turns on windy days. The flat side catches waves and will spray you unless you stay in the gas and make the turn at speed before you get off the throttle. They run pretty flat, but still have good speed, will turn on a dime and you can plaster your passenger up against the side of the boat if you catch them off guard and turn it hard starboard and hit the throttle. I think some boats weren't sealed well when they put the top cap on, I know of a couple of boats that were getting heavier with age, assuming it was water logged foam. Had mine 18 years, sold it and now have a 21' Triton Elite. Love the Triton, but there are things I miss about the Cobra. Holeshot, turning, rough water ride, huge rod lockers. Defnately don't miss the small battery compartment.
